The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Jenbach to Venice is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id traveling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Jenbach to Venice will cost around $86 if you buy it on the day, but the cheapest tickets can be found for only $37.
Of the 4 trains that leave Jenbach for Venice on Thu, Dec 11, 4 travel direct so it’s quite easy to avoid journeys where you’ll have to change along the way.
On Thu, Dec 11 the direct trains cover the 221 km distance in an average of 7 h 46 m but if you time it right, some trains will get you there in just 5 h 25 m .
On Thu, Dec 11 the slowest trains will take 11 h 28 m and usually involve a change or two along the way, but you might be able to save a few pennies if you’re on a budget.

Overview: Train from Jenbach to Venice
Trains from Jenbach to Venice run on average 4 times per day, taking around 5h 9m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$26 (€21) if you book in advance.
There are 2 trains per day. The earliest train runs at 00:35, the last at 21:17. The fastest train covers the 137 miles (221 km) distance in 5h 13m.
